Springs Newcastle is a motel in Newcastle, New South Wales, Australia, located about 6.6mi from the city center. The address is Level 2, 4 Tyrrell Street, Wallsend. With 1,176 reviews and rates starting from $113, this listing welcomes travelers seeking value and comfort.
Amenities include free on-site parking, a free kids' club, an on-site restaurant, and complimentary Wi-Fi, plus room service and a streaming service (like Netflix). Creature comforts include air conditioning and a spa tub, private entrances, balconies, and soundproofed rooms, with a patio offering a landmark view. Additional conveniences include a bar, non-smoking rooms, wheelchair accessibility, an elevator with access to upper floors, extra-long beds, free toiletries, a bathtub, and kids' meals available for an extra charge.

So convenient . The diggers Club right next door for breakfast lumch or dinner. You get a members discount cause your staying at the hotel . Shopping centre and town a walk away . Perfect if you need to stay to support family at john hunter . It was quiet , safe , easy parking and rooms were bigger than normal . The staff were so friendly and the manager was lovely .

Our room was very clean and the very large bed was very comfortable. Was able to park car just outside the entrance. Lady on duty was very nice and helpful.
Bit hard to locate, on top of a car park, and coming in after sunset was difficult to find. A bit more signage would help. Restaurant is not actually on site, you have to walk along a walkway over a road to get to Diggers Club where the restaurant & bar were.
